Is it right to study for the whole night and sleep in the day time? If so, how is it going to benefit or affect my studies and health?

Frankly speaking, I can't imagine a person studying with full concentration in the day time. There are so many distractions during the day. You phone rings every other moment. You mom comes in frequently to ask you to eat something. Your sister is talking endlessly on her phone in the adjoining room. Kids come rushing in your room giggling. You can't ignore that favourite song of yours playing on the TV in the next room. How can you concentrate on your studies in the center of all these distractions?
I have always preferred to study in the pin drop silence of the night. My output would be multiple times more during the night.
So, as far as study is concerned, you will definitely gain a lot, while studying at night.
This may however, as they say, disturb your biological clock. But how can it affect your health, I am unable to find. I have been all night awake for months together, but never found any adverse effect on my health.
But yes, you must have enough sleep during the day. That is a must.
So, if you feel more comfortable to study at night, go ahead and win the world.

How will not having a degree affect my career?
2021-06-21 05:56:14【Mr_能】
Generally it won't affect your ability and knowledge as you develop your skills. And you gain good experience. Y
But here's the problem - right now you're a lower level guy so companies hire a bunch of them, therefore lots of opportunities.
As you get older and more experience, there are fewer jobs available (you only need one supervisor for six techs, or one manager for six supervisors or one director for three managers etc.).
So the stakes get higher and the requirements get tougher, plus the guys you're competing with have the degrees and Network, Engineering etc qualifications.
So you don't get to the interview, even though you have the experience to do the job Because the guys youre competing with do have that piece of paper.
And the reason for that is either:
- because the guy doing the hiring has 18 applications for the job. He doesn't have time to interview all 18, so he picks the 6 (3?, 2?)that look best on paper.
Three live interviews, two on Skype, one on the phone. Pick the two best candidates and they get a second interview.
Done. No interview for you because you didn't make the first cut.
Or:
- company policy requires a degree- so either way, you're screwed.
Get the degree now while you're young and have the time. Once you get locked in with a spouse, family and commitments it's really difficult to get a degree.

Do you let your teenager sleep all day and stay up all night? Why or why not?
2021-08-21 11:05:23【Mr_干】
No. When my son was a teenager there was an understanding that sufficient sleep needed to be a priority. My husband and I were often very tired in the evening during the week and we needed our sleep. We were usually in bed at 9 or 9:30 p.m. and my son went to bed about 30 minutes earlier. We realized that was an early bedtime so all we asked was that he did quiet activities (we encouraged reading) until he was sleepy. We were more lenient on weekends especially when he was socially active. I knew from my teaching experience the importance of getting enough sleep, having worked with teens who were seriously sleep deprived. Staying up all night and sleepIng all day was never an option in our home.
How do I complete my studies if I cannot afford to study abroad?
2021-08-24 06:10:00【Mr_万俟】
If one accepts the philosophy that the purpose of education is to teach people how to teach themselves, then self study is first step. Firstly be sure you are on the right study track, ie what you really want to do, get the curriculum, get the books, get the videos (youtube), set targets, train your memory, find (retired?) correspondents who are willing to interact with you. And do what every man has difficulty doing - ask questions. It’s possible, and when you get through it you will know you have achieved something special.
